LANGLAIS FESTIVALSUMMER CHORAL WEEK
directed by
MALCOLM ARCHERwith DAVID BEDNALL (organ)
HILARY JONES (vocal coach)
and COLIN SPINKS (repetiteur)
Saturday 18th to Saturday 25th July 2015
1
AIMS OF THE CHORAL WEEK
to study and perform choral works by Jean Langlais, his contemporaries, those who influenced him and those he has influenced, together with great music of the Anglican tradition
to bring experienced singers together in the Breton village where Langlais was born
to work intensively with living composers who are professionals of the highest calibre
to perform in three events during the Langlais International Festival 2015
For the past seven years we have run a successful and unique choral week under the expert leadership of Malcolm Archer, and we shall be repeating it in 2015. We are now seeking to recruit experienced singers who can expect to make good music in convivial surroundings and, in the process, become le Chœur de l’Académie du Festival Jean Langlais.
MUSIC FOR THE 2015 CHORAL WEEK
We will be focusing on the following works (subject to amendment):
Mozart : Missa Brevis in C (K259) Mozart : Ave Verum Corpus César Franck : Psalm 150 Fauré : Requiem Poulenc : Salve Regina Villette : O Salutaris HostiaStanford : Latin Magnificat Holst : Nunc dimittis Langlais : Tantum Ergo James MacMillan : O Radiant Dawn Rutter : Hymn to the Creator of Light Archer : A Hymn for St CeciliaBednall : Aspire to God Handel : Zadok
A basic level of sight-singing ability will be essential, and singers should try to learn the music before the course begins. Copies of scores will be sent three months in advance.

STRUCTURE OF THE WEEK
There will normally be two rehearsal periods each day at 3 Rue du Moulin, la Fontenelle. We have been invited to sing Sunday morning mass at the church of la Fontenelle, and we shall perform in two concerts : at the Abbaye de Saint Melaine in Rennes (where we sang in 2013) and at la Fontenelle.
Vocal coach Hilary Jones will be giving whole choir warm-up sessions each day and she will “voice” the choir. Each participant is also entitled to a 20 minute individual lesson with Hilary (included in the choral week fees), but singers may book additional half-hour (£20/20€) or hour-long (£40/40€) sessions with her during the week.
There will also be a series of lectures which take place each day just before lunch. Last year’s topics ranged from “Transforming our singing” to “Jean Langlais : international music star” and “the French vocal school”.
